Children’s health is getting worse – and relationships matter

The latest State of Child Health 2026 report from the Royal College of Paediatrics and Child Health (RCPCH) makes for uncomfortable reading.  Nearly ten years after the first report was published, the picture for children and young people in England is not improving. In many areas, progress has stalled or gone backwards, while inequalities between children growing up in the most and least disadvantaged communities remain stark.

 

The RCPCH has analysed 12 key indicators of children’s health and wellbeing. Its conclusion is clear: we need to do more, and we need to do it sooner.

Health is about more than healthcare

The report highlights the powerful influence of the circumstances in which children grow up. Poverty, deprivation and wider social inequalities are closely linked to poorer health outcomes.  It also highlights worrying inequalities in child mortality, mental health and other areas of children's health and wellbeing.

 

These findings reinforce something that organisations working directly with families see every day: children's wellbeing is shaped by their relationships, their communities and the opportunities they have to thrive - not simply by what happens when they need medical care.

 

The RCPCH is calling for greater investment in children's health, better data and clear national targets to improve children's health and reduce inequalities. It also stresses the importance of prevention and tackling the underlying causes of poor outcomes.  We believe that strong relationships should be part of that preventative approach.

 

We cannot solve the challenges facing children through healthcare alone. Supporting families, strengthening relationships and giving children positive experiences and trusted adults around them are all part of helping children grow up healthy and well.

A healthier future for every child

The RCPCH warns that without urgent action, we risk raising one of the unhealthiest generations of children in recent decades. Its report also highlights how strongly children's health outcomes are affected by inequality.

 

There is no single answer to this challenge.  But investing in children means investing not only in health services, schools and communities, but also in the relationships that help children feel secure, supported and valued.
